Hanasaki Crab introduction
Hanasaki Crab (花咲ガニ, Hanasaki gani) is a member of the hermit crab family, part of the King Crab species, and is in season from summer to autumn. Known for its thick, meaty legs and dense flesh, this crab boasts a rich, intense flavor and a unique, sweet aroma. Due to this strong flavor, it is rarely eaten raw. Instead, it’s often prepared by grilling with salt, boiling, or made into "Teppo-jiru," a miso soup featuring chunks of its legs. When thoroughly cooked, its shells release chitosan, which is said to have potential health benefits like aiding in weight loss.
